About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Identify the right artifacts based on project needs and timeline
- Deliver high-quality w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ity specifications
- Set the vision for the user experience
- Develop understanding and empathy for users through user-centered methodologies, external analysis, research, and data
- Present design decisions and design strategy to peers, partners, and cross-functional leadership
- Improve design processes and workflows across the broader design organization
- Contribute to and improve design systems and UX patterns
- Collaborate with product managers, engineers, design leads, and other cross-functional partners to define requirements and deliver projects
- Engage with designers to exchange ideas, share skills, and provide mentorship
- Mentor associate designers and peers; may have direct reports
- Leverage design tools to deliver artifacts, drive collaboration, and improve broader design-team workflow
- Create and maintain UI/UX resources such as content templates, samples, and guidelines
- Analyze user research, business insights, and other data to continuously improve customer experiences
- Review proposed product changes or enhancements for compliance with user-experience and satisfaction standards
Requirements
What you’ll need- At least 5 years of hands-on experience in or with a product design organization
- Expert knowledge of Figma
- Deep understanding of user-centered design methodologies, research, and processes
- Ability to share solutions and strategy to problem-solving initiatives in an engaging way
- Proactive and energetic communicator with attention to detail
- Background verification check required as a condition of employment
- Bachelor's Degree (listed as the study level)
- Preferred: 8–10 years of experience in product design, preferably within a mature product organisation
- Preferred: Proven experience leading and mentoring a small team of designers
- Preferred: Experience designing complex enterprise tools and workflows for internal users
- Preferred: Excellent communication, articulation, and storytelling skills, with the ability to influence and align stakeholders
